The FICM sync and cam/crank sync are important when cranking and running.
For the KOEO those two should read O or none.
But leave them in there. Not worth taking them out just to add them back when doing a cranking or running diagnostic.

If that KOEO is prior to attempting to crank the engine then your ICP voltage is off.
You shouldn’t have .3v KOEO unless you have been kranking the truck and immediately check values KOEO. Even then the hp oil will bleed off slowly.

Find a scanner that can read the following list.
With the KeyOnEngineOff (KOEO) record the following.
ICP voltage
ICP pressure
IPR percentage
Baro
MAP
EBP
VGT percentage
MAF voltage
ECT
EOT
FICM voltage
FICM sync (cranking and running)
CMP/CKP sync (cranking and running)
RPM
